The Samsung Galaxy S22 Ultra 5G, released in February 2022, and the Apple iPhone 13 Pro, launched in September 2021, represent high-end smartphone offerings from their respective manufacturers. While both devices aim to deliver a premium mobile experience, they cater to different user preferences through their distinct operating systems and hardware philosophies. The Galaxy S22 Ultra stands out with its integrated stylus and larger display, whereas the iPhone 13 Pro emphasizes a streamlined user experience and robust ecosystem.

Durability

When considering the long-term usability of these devices, several factors contribute to their expected practical lifespan.

  • Release Timeline and Software Support: The iPhone 13 Pro, released in September 2021, typically receives iOS updates for approximately five to six years from its launch date, ensuring continued access to new features and security patches. The Galaxy S22 Ultra, launched in February 2022, generally receives four years of Android operating system updates and five years of security updates from Samsung. This means the iPhone 13 Pro may offer a slightly longer period of major OS updates, while both provide substantial security support.
  • Repairability: The iPhone 13 Pro received an iFixit repairability score of 5 out of 10. While display and battery replacements are considered feasible, certain repairs, particularly screen replacements, can impact features like Face ID if not performed by authorized service providers. The Galaxy S22 Ultra scored lower, with an iFixit repairability score of 3 out of 10. This is largely due to the extensive use of strong adhesive, which makes disassembling the device and replacing components like the battery and screen more challenging.
  • Practical Lifespan: Both devices are built with durable materials and are rated for dust and water resistance (IP68), suggesting they can withstand daily use. The iPhone 13 Pro features a Ceramic Shield front cover, designed for enhanced drop performance. The Galaxy S22 Ultra also uses Gorilla Glass Victus+ for its front and back, contributing to its resilience. Users can expect several years of reliable performance from either device, with software support being a primary differentiator for long-term feature access.

Performance

Both smartphones offer robust performance capabilities, designed to handle demanding applications and multitasking with ease.

  • Processing Power: The iPhone 13 Pro is equipped with a powerful chip that delivers smooth and responsive performance across various tasks, from everyday navigation to graphically intensive gaming and video editing. Users report that heavy apps and games run smoothly. The Galaxy S22 Ultra features a current-generation processor that also provides strong performance, ensuring applications load quickly and multitasking remains fluid.
  • Storage and RAM: The iPhone 13 Pro is available with storage options ranging from 128GB up to 1TB, providing ample space for apps, photos, and videos. It includes 6GB of RAM, which contributes to efficient multitasking. The Galaxy S22 Ultra offers similar storage configurations, from 128GB to 1TB, and can be configured with either 8GB or 12GB of RAM, allowing for extensive app usage and background processes.
  • Battery Behavior: The iPhone 13 Pro features a 3095 mAh battery, which users generally find sufficient for a full day of use, even with moderate to heavy activity. It supports fast charging and wireless charging. The Galaxy S22 Ultra houses a larger 5000 mAh battery, often praised by users for its extended endurance, capable of lasting through a full day and sometimes beyond, depending on usage patterns. It also supports faster wired charging, wireless charging, and reverse wireless charging.

Screen quality

The display is a central feature for both devices, offering vibrant visuals and smooth interactions, though with some key differences in size and technology.

  • Display Technology and Clarity: The iPhone 13 Pro features a 6.1-inch Super Retina XDR OLED display, known for its deep blacks, vibrant colors, and excellent contrast. It has a resolution of 2532 x 1170 pixels, resulting in a sharp 460 pixels per inch (ppi). The Galaxy S22 Ultra boasts a larger 6.8-inch Dynamic AMOLED 2X display with a higher resolution of 3088 x 1440 pixels, yielding approximately 500 ppi, offering exceptional clarity and detail.
  • Brightness and Refresh Rate: Both phones offer high brightness levels, with the iPhone 13 Pro reaching up to 1000 nits typical brightness and 1200 nits peak for HDR content. The Galaxy S22 Ultra can achieve an even higher peak brightness of 1750 nits, making it particularly well-suited for outdoor visibility. Both devices feature adaptive refresh rates up to 120Hz, providing a fluid scrolling experience and responsive touch interactions. The iPhone's ProMotion technology can scale down to 10Hz to conserve battery, while the Galaxy S22 Ultra's adaptive refresh rate also optimizes for efficiency.
  • Screen Size and Viewing Experience: The iPhone 13 Pro's 6.1-inch display offers a compact yet immersive viewing experience, suitable for one-handed use. The Galaxy S22 Ultra's larger 6.8-inch screen provides an expansive canvas, ideal for media consumption, productivity, and gaming, offering more screen real estate for content.

Audiovisual

Both smartphones are equipped with advanced camera systems designed to capture high-quality photos and videos in various conditions.

  • Camera System Configuration: The iPhone 13 Pro features a versatile triple 12MP camera system, including a wide, ultra-wide, and telephoto lens with 3x optical zoom. It also incorporates a LiDAR scanner for improved depth sensing. The Galaxy S22 Ultra offers a quad-camera setup, highlighted by a 108MP main sensor, a 12MP ultrawide, and two 10MP telephoto lenses, providing 3x and 10x optical zoom capabilities, including a periscope telephoto lens for extended reach.
  • Photography Performance: The iPhone 13 Pro excels in capturing detailed and color-accurate images, with significant improvements in low-light performance across its lenses due to larger sensors and wider apertures. Its macro photography mode allows for close-up shots. The Galaxy S22 Ultra's 108MP main sensor captures a high level of detail, and its advanced zoom capabilities allow for distant subjects to be brought closer with clarity. Both devices offer strong low-light performance, though their approaches to image processing can differ.
  • Video Recording and Features: The iPhone 13 Pro introduces Cinematic Mode, which provides a shallow depth of field effect for videos, and supports ProRes video recording for professional-grade footage. It can record up to 4K at 60fps. The Galaxy S22 Ultra is capable of recording video up to 8K at 24fps and 4K at 30/60fps, offering high-resolution video capture. Both phones include features like optical image stabilization for smooth video.

Miscellaneous

Beyond core performance, several practical elements differentiate the user experience of these two devices.

  • Connectivity and Ports: Both the iPhone 13 Pro and Galaxy S22 Ultra support 5G connectivity, Wi-Fi 6, and Bluetooth 5.0 (iPhone 13 Pro) or 5.2 (Galaxy S22 Ultra), ensuring fast and reliable wireless connections. The iPhone 13 Pro uses Apple's proprietary Lightning port for charging and data transfer, while the Galaxy S22 Ultra features a more universal USB-C port. Both support dual SIM functionality (nano-SIM and eSIM).
  • Biometric Security and Sensors: The iPhone 13 Pro relies on Face ID for secure facial recognition. It also includes a LiDAR scanner, which enhances augmented reality experiences and improves autofocus in low light. The Galaxy S22 Ultra utilizes an ultrasonic in-display fingerprint sensor for biometric authentication, alongside facial recognition. It also integrates an S Pen stylus, offering precise input for notes, drawings, and navigation, a feature unique to the Ultra line.
  • Design and Handling: The iPhone 13 Pro measures 146.7 x 71.5 x 7.65 mm and weighs 204 grams, featuring a flat-edged design with a stainless steel frame and a matte glass back. The Galaxy S22 Ultra is larger and heavier at 163.3 x 77.9 x 8.9 mm and 228 grams, with a more curved design, a glass front and back, and an aluminum frame. The iPhone's smaller size generally makes it easier for one-handed use, while the Galaxy S22 Ultra's larger form factor accommodates its expansive display and integrated S Pen.

The Samsung Galaxy S22 Ultra 5G and the iPhone 13 Pro each offer a compelling smartphone experience, appealing to different user priorities. Users frequently praise the iPhone 13 Pro for its consistent performance, excellent camera system, and the smooth, integrated experience of its operating system. Its battery life is often highlighted as a significant improvement over previous models, providing reliable all-day power. Some users, however, express a desire for a more universal charging port than the Lightning connector and note that third-party screen repairs can sometimes affect Face ID functionality.

The Galaxy S22 Ultra is often lauded for its expansive and vibrant display, highly versatile camera system with impressive zoom capabilities, and the unique productivity features offered by its integrated S Pen. Its large battery capacity is also a common point of praise. Conversely, some users find its size and weight substantial, and the repairability score suggests that repairs can be more challenging due to the internal design.

Users prioritizing a compact device with a highly optimized software experience and a strong, consistent camera for everyday photography and videography may find the iPhone 13 Pro well-suited to their needs. Those who value a larger display for media and multitasking, advanced zoom photography, and the unique functionality of a built-in stylus for creativity and productivity may lean toward the Galaxy S22 Ultra.
